Chris BrownChris Brown opened up about his assault on former girlfriend Rihanna during the MTV News special “Chris Brown: The Interview” on Friday (November 6), elaborating on his destructive behavior, explaining his previous apologies and describing his ongoing therapy sessions.

According to mtvnews.com, Brown told MTV News correspondent Sway that he has finally come to terms with the fact that he was capable of such violence.

“I think you’d be in denial and be totally naive not to,” he said. “And not being able to realize and own up to the fact of your own wrongs. I mean, me, I’ve come to terms with it and I’m working on it. … For that moment or whatever had me at that place, I want to erase that from what my character is. I want to be totally different from now on. I don’t want to be that person.”

“I’m confused right now as far as the public perception [of me],” he said. “Like, I think with my fans, they still love me, they support me, definitely. You have those people who will support you. So it’s kinda like 50/50 for me. I got the people that will come out and support and then the people that don’t wanna see me do anything. They basically want me in jail.”

Rihanna Speaks Out About Her Assault By Chris Brown

RihannaRihanna spoke candidly about being assaulted by Chris Brown in her first televised interview since the February incident. She said the assault was “humiliating” and “traumatizing,” and admitted that going back to Brown shortly after it happened it was “wrong.”

According to mtvnews.com, Rihanna told Diane Sawyer that it was “embarrassing that that’s the type of person that I fell in love with.” The interview aired in part on “Good Morning America” on Thursday (November 5) and will air in full on “20/20″ Friday night. “[I was] so far in love, so unconditional that I went back. It’s humiliating to say this happened. To accept that? It’s a traumatizing experience.”

Rihanna told Sawyer that on February 8, Brown put her in a headlock twice and bit her ears and fingers. Soon after the incident, a police photo leaked, showing the singer to be badly bruised. But weeks later, she and Brown were spotted vacationing together in Miami.

“I stayed. I even went back after he beat me, which was wrong,” she admitted. “But again … I’m a human being, and people put me on a very unrealistic pedestal. And all these expectations, I’m not perfect. Also it’s pretty natural for that to be the first reaction. … It’s completely normal to go back. You start lying to yourself. The minute the physical wounds go away you want this thing to go away. This is a memory you don’t want to have ever again.”

Rihanna and Ne-Yo Collaborate On ‘Russian Roulette’

rihannaWhen Ne-yo and Rihanna collaborate on tracks, the result is usually pretty spectacular.

Apparently, fans can expect nothing less with their new collaboration, “Russian Roulette.” The Barbadian beauty used the help of co-producer Chuck Harmony for the latest single on her upcoming Rated R album.

According to MTV News, Ne-yo explained that Rihanna specifically requested the song’s somber vibe. “She wanted it to be dark, but not just dark for the sake of dark [...] dark with a kind of meaning, dark with some kind of thing to it.”

The ominous Russian roulette theme is something new for the soulful singer. He called the track “my first ventures off into the fictitious.”

“I’m listening to the track, and all I can see is Rihanna and some random person sitting across from each other at the table with a gun sitting in the middle of the table and playing Russian roulette,” he explained. “And I just started thinking, ‘What would go through your mind if you was in that situation?’ It just all started coming together, and Rihanna has never been one to be afraid to take a chance, especially with me. She’s always game to do something a little different. I played it for her, and she loved it — went in and knocked it out. The rest is history.”

September Means Business for Jay-Z

Jay-ZThe wait for Jay-Z’s much-hyped new album will be over sooner than expected thanks to an Internet leak, according to NME.com.

The Blueprint 3 will now be released tomorrow (Sept. 8), three days earlier than plan. This will mark Hova’s third album following his alleged retirement in 2003 and the third instalment in his critically-revered Blueprint series. The Sept. 11 release was originally planned to fall eight years to the day following the 2001 release of Blueprint.

Despite being overshadowed by the 9/11 attacks, Blueprint still sold 426,000 copies in its first week and has since been named a must-have album by nearly every music critic out there. It even squeezed into Rolling Stone’s 500 Greatest Albums of All Time list at #464.

The online leak of the much-awaited Blueprint 3 was a minor hitch in Jay’s plan.

“I may be the most bootlegged artist in history,” he told MTV News. “It’s a preview. I’m excited for people to hear the album. I’m very proud of the work I’ve done, so enjoy it.”

Chris Brown Sentenced for Assaulting Rihanna

Chris BrownChris Brown was sentenced today to five years probation and six months hard labour for assaulting Rihanna earlier this year, according to TMZ.com. Brown pleaded guilty to felony assault.

Judge Patricia Schnegg ruled Brown must stay 100 yards away from Rihanna at all times, in the exception of entertainment events where he must stay 10 yards away. This ruling extends for five years. According to TMZ.com, Public Information Officer Sandi Gibbons said Judge Schnegg also told Brown the sentence is not a slap on the wrist and she is aware of his celebrity status. She said she will sentence him to prison time if he violates his probation.

Wrigley Drops Chris Brown

Chris BrownWrigley Gum has formally terminated their contract with Chris Brown, reports Perez Hilton. The company suspended its advertising campaign featuring the singer after an incident in February where Brown was accused of beating then-girlfriend Rihanna.

At the time, the company said it believed “Mr. Brown should be afforded the same due process as any citizen.”

Following Brown’s guilty plea to a felony assault, the Doublemint gum-maker has ended its relationship with the star.
